> @@ -96,6 +98,7 @@ struct dma_buf *dma_buf_export(void *priv, const struct
> dma_buf_ops *ops, struct file *file;
>
> if (WARN_ON(!priv || !ops
> + || !ops->owner

THIS_MODULE is defined as ((struct module *)0) when the driver is built-in,
this check should thus be removed.

> || !ops->map_dma_buf
> || !ops->unmap_dma_buf
> || !ops->release
